About Haifeng Jiao

Haifeng Jiao is a scholar working on Physiology, Cell Biology and Epidemiology, having authored 12 papers that have together received 516 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Autophagy in Disease and Therapy (6 papers), Endoplasmic Reticulum Stress and Disease (4 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(3 papers), Cellular transport and secretion (3 papers),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(2 papers), Calcium signaling and nucleotide metabolism (2 papers), Adenosine and Purinergic Signaling (1 paper) and interferon and immune responses (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Cell Biology (109 citations), Physiology (30 citations) and Cancer Research (83 citations). Haifeng Jiao has collaborated with scholars based in China, France and Singapore. Frequent co-authors include Li Yu, Ying Li, Xiaoyu Hu, Takami Sho, Wanqing Du, Yuzhuo Yang, Dong Jiang, Yau‐Huei Wei, Xiaopeng Li and Liangliang Ji. Their work appears in journals such as The Journal of Cell Biology, Cell Death and Differentiation, Autophagy, Cell Research and Ocean Engineering.
